My 7.3 does not like doing heavy work when it's cold. I give it about 5 minutes to warm up before pulling the fifth wheel out, then take it nice and slow out of the CG. By the time I hit the highway, it's usually warmed up and ready to pull.
If it's been below 40 or 50 the night before, I'll plug in the block heater for about 4 hours before hitching up and pulling out. That helps tremendously.
My truck has the same engine and transmission as the OP, but with my 4.88 rear end, I can climb hills without much difficulty. What's your axle ratio, Shadows4?
